Get started1 Belmont Cottages is a three-bedroom end-of-terrace house in Pirbright, Woking, Woking (GU24 0QG). It has a recorded floor area of 95 m² (around 1023 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1900-1929 and council tax band E. The latest certificate (March 2020) shows a D (score 58), a step below the typical UK home. When first surveyed in April 2010 the rating was E, the property has climbed 1 band since. Between certificates, wall efficiency went from Very Poor to Poor; while roof efficiency dropped from Poor to Very Poor and lighting dropped from Very Good to Very Poor. The recommended improvements would push it to C (score 77).
Sale prices here have outpaced Woking HPI: 5.2% per year against 0% for the wider region. Today's modelled estimate of £553,000 is 27.1% above the 2020 sale price.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£425/sq ft) was about 26.9% above the typical sold price in the postcode. Last sale on file: £435,000 in June 2020. Across the public record there are 6 sales, relatively high churn for a single property. 2 planning records sit against the property, 2 approved, 0 refused. Past consents include an extension and a loft conversion, meaningful when judging how the property has evolved.
Planning history includes both a loft conversion and an extension — the classic family-home expansion.
